🌱 Growing Information

  • Botanical Name: Zingiber officinale
  • Common Name: Edible Ginger, Culinary Ginger
  • Plant Type: Tropical Herbaceous Perennial
  • Plant Size: Rooted plug
  • Light: Partial shade to bright indirect light
  • Soil: Rich, loose, well-draining soil with plenty of organic matter
  • Water: Keep soil consistently moist but not waterlogged
  • USDA Hardiness: Zones 8–12
  • Mature Size: Approximately 3–4 feet tall and 2–3 feet wide
